Understanding Web3
Web3, often referred to as the decentralized web, is an evolution of the internet that emphasizes decentralization, transparency, and user control. Unlike Web2, where centralized platforms like Facebook and Google dominate, Web3 aims to distribute control and data ownership back to the users. Blockchain technology forms the backbone of Web3, enabling secure, peer-to-peer transactions and data sharing without the need for intermediaries.
At the heart of Web3 is the concept of decentralized identity (DID). DID allows individuals to own and control their digital identities, granting them the ability to share their identity information securely and selectively with third parties. This is a significant shift from the current system, where identity data is often scattered across multiple, often untrustworthy, centralized platforms.

Consider the rise of decentralized finance (DeFi). This rapidly evolving sector is essentially rebuilding traditional financial services – lending, borrowing, trading, insurance – on blockchain networks. Instead of relying on banks, intermediaries, and centralized exchanges, DeFi allows individuals to interact directly with smart contracts, automated agreements that execute when predefined conditions are met. This disintermediation drastically reduces fees, increases efficiency, and opens up access to financial instruments that were previously out of reach for many.
Within the Blockchain Wealth Engine, this translates into opportunities like yield farming, where users can earn passive income by providing liquidity to DeFi protocols. Staking cryptocurrencies allows you to earn rewards for holding and supporting a network’s operation. Non-fungible tokens (NFTs), once primarily associated with digital art, are now finding utility in representing ownership of everything from in-game assets to real-world property, creating new markets and monetization models. Furthermore, the engine is increasingly being powered by advancements in zero-knowledge proofs (ZKPs) and other privacy-enhancing technologies. While transparency is a hallmark of blockchain, there are legitimate concerns about privacy. ZKPs allow for the verification of information without revealing the underlying data, enabling more private transactions and more secure data management within blockchain ecosystems. This is crucial for the broader adoption of the Blockchain Wealth Engine, as it addresses privacy concerns that might otherwise deter individuals and institutions from engaging with decentralized technologies.
